Moon Buggy is an arcade video game written by John Kennedy and published by Boldfield Limited Computing. Moon Buggy is a copy of the famous video game Moon Patrol written for ZX Spectrum.
You are in the role of Sam, a fearless rescuer of his friends who are stuck somewhere on the Moon. Your task is to rescue your friends and bring them safely to their homes. In order to reach them and achieve the goal of the game, it is necessary to avoid holes, mines, walls, bombs and meteorites with your buggy.
You can select two levels of play: 1. difficult and 2. more difficult, and two levels of speed, Q - fast and W - slow. Controls in game are: Q - missile ... W - pause game ... S - restart game ... P - right ... A - laser ... I - left ... O - jump ... G - go.
